
Software Engineer
Veradigm®
full-time
Posted on:
Location Type: Hybrid
Location: Pune • India
Visit company websiteExplore more
About the role
- Design and develop applications using C#, .NET Core, and ASP.NET Core
- Build and maintain RESTful APIs and backend services
- Write efficient, optimized SQL queries and support database feature development
- Apply SOLID principles and clean architecture practices
- Participate in Agile ceremonies and sprint execution
- Debug, profile, and improve application performance
- Collaborate with QA, Product, and DevOps teams
- Ensure code quality through reviews and adherence to engineering standards
Requirements
- 2–4 years of hands-on experience in C# and .NET Core
- Strong understanding of OOP, SOLID principles, and design patterns
- Experience building applications using ASP.NET Core and Web APIs
- Working knowledge of Entity Framework
- Strong SQL Server experience including complex queries and schema understanding
- Good understanding of data structures and basic algorithms
- Basic understanding of microservices architecture
- Experience working in Agile environments
- Strong JavaScript fundamentals; basic exposure to Angular or similar frameworks
Benefits
- Quarterly Company-Wide Recharge Days
- Flexible Work Environment (Remote/Hybrid Options)
- Peer-based incentive “Cheer” awards
- Tuition Reimbursement Program
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
C#.NET CoreASP.NET CoreRESTful APIsSQLEntity FrameworkOOPSOLID principlesJavaScriptmicroservices architecture
Soft Skills
collaborationcode qualityproblem-solvingcommunicationAgile methodology